Clear Filters
Clear Filters

how to extract just a value lower than 1

5 views (last 30 days)
Hi all,
I have a .mat file containing a varied number from less than 0 to much more than 0. I would like to extract or just concentrate on value just below 0, I will give them as 1. Also, the numbers which are greater than 1, I would give them as 0.
I know if statement is useful for this, but I don't know how to do that. Anyway, is there any function like x(isnan(x))=0 that change the conditional number below 0 to be 1?
Thanks in advance, Pich

Accepted Answer

Walter Roberson
Walter Roberson on 8 Nov 2016
x(x < 0) = 1;
x(x > 1) = 0;
  1 Comment
Pichawut Manopkawee
Pichawut Manopkawee on 8 Nov 2016
Thanks Walter,
I just know that there is an easy way to cope with this. Thanks again.
Pich

Sign in to comment.

More Answers (0)

Categories

Find more on Data Import and Analysis in Help Center and File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!